PHP Fatal error: Call to a member function find() on a non-object in$elements2 = $html2->find('#streamlinks .sideleft a');
so its confusing as to what is causing this error to appear in my error log file?
I'd try to output $element->href
befor you do the file_get_html.
If the file_get_html can't get a page $html2
stays uniinitialized and you can't use find on it.
Beside that you could build a check wether $html2
is set after the file_get_html and output an error if not. I usually use something like this:
if($html2 == false || $html2 == NULL){
// no html found
}else{
// html found
}
